🌎 What is USMLE?

The United States Medical Licensing Examination (USMLE) is a three-step exam required for medical licensure in the United States. It’s a mandatory path for foreign and U.S. medical graduates aiming to practice medicine in the USA.

It is globally recognized and challenging but opens doors to residency, licensure, and career opportunities in the U.S.

📝 USMLE Exam Steps

Step 1

Tests knowledge of basic sciences. Pass/fail based. 280 MCQs in 8 hours. Requires ECFMG registration.

Step 2 (CK)

Evaluates clinical knowledge in fields like OB-GYN, Pediatrics, Internal Medicine. 320 MCQs in 9 hours.

Step 3

Final step to get licensed. Two-day test with 232 questions and patient simulation. Requires completion of Step 1 & 2.

Topics:
  • Patient Management
  • Clinical Decision-Making
  • Public Health

🎓 USMLE Exam Pattern

  • Step 1: 280 MCQs (7 blocks, 1 hr each)
  • Step 2 CK: 320 MCQs (8 blocks)
  • Step 3: 2-day test (MCQs + CCS simulation)
